## Deployment

Welcome to the Tallyfin team. The metrics-aggregation sidecar runs alongside every application pod and forwards rolled-up counters to the central collector. New team members should deploy it via the shared chart rather than hand-written manifests, since the chart enforces resource limits and the correct service account. Never point a development sidecar at the production collector; the aggregator deduplicates by pod identity and will silently drop your data. A standard deployment uses the configuration shown below.

settings of tagef-bawif:
DRUIX_HOST=druix.zemvarlabs.internal
DRUIX_PORT=8000

Ticket TILE-PREFETCH: Sign-off required for Cartowl map-tile prefetcher

The prefetcher speculatively downloads tiles around a user's viewport and caches them on-device. Before release, we need security review of the cache eviction policy, the handling of tiles for restricted regions, and confirmation that prefetch requests carry no location telemetry beyond the tile coordinates themselves. Full threat notes are attached to the ticket. Sign-off authority rests with the reviewer named below.

account owner for bawip-tahag: Raleth Quenok

Assignments must be deterministic: the hash salt and bucket count may never change mid-experiment, or users will be reshuffled and the analysis invalidated. Rollouts therefore use blue-green switches, never rolling restarts, so both replicas always agree on the active experiment manifest. The manifest is fetched at boot and cached; a SIGHUP forces a refresh. Production runs with the configuration values below.

deployment values, fahap-hahaf:
[casdor]
port = 9200
region = south-2
host = casdor.qirvanworks.corp
timeout_ms = 3000
retries = 4

Handover — Training Budget FY Next

Marra,

Short version: training budget drafted at last year's level plus 6%. Leadership track for Northvale branch is funded; the Brightloom certification scheme is not — defer to Q2 review. Vendor contracts with Ostler Learning renew automatically unless cancelled by January. Heads of department have seen the headline figures only. Keep the detailed allocations with you until sign-off. One item requires discretion: the budget assumes a restructure not yet announced. The relevant note is appended below.

internal memo for hahif-hahaf: Headcount on the Zorwyn team goes from 9 to 100 by the end of October. Gross margin on Zorwyn came in at 5 percent against a plan of 10 percent.